GEN 111

Language and Literacy in Early Childhood

Catalog description

This course will examine current research focused on language and literacy development in early childhood. Concepts in the course will address developmental stages, instructional strategies, and factors that contribute to foundational language and literacy skills. The course will also address how to support emergent language and literacy skills with children from various backgrounds and strengthen the home-school partnership.
